黑狐家游戏

关系型数据库的结构是什么,关系型数据库的结构是,关系型数据库结构的深入剖析与优化策略

欧气 0 0
关系型数据库结构主要由表、记录和字段组成。深入剖析涉及表与表之间的关系、数据完整性约束等。优化策略包括索引优化、查询优化和存储优化,以提高数据库性能。

本文目录导读:

  1. 关系型数据库结构
  2. 关系型数据库优化策略

关系型数据库是当今信息系统中最为广泛使用的数据库类型之一,它以关系模型为基础,通过二维表的形式来组织数据,实现了数据的结构化存储和高效查询,本文将深入剖析关系型数据库的结构,并探讨优化策略,以提升数据库的性能和稳定性。

关系型数据库结构

1、关系模型

关系型数据库的核心是关系模型,它将数据组织成一张张二维表,每一张表包含多个行和列,行代表数据记录,列代表数据字段,关系模型遵循以下基本规则:

关系型数据库的结构是什么,关系型数据库的结构是,关系型数据库结构的深入剖析与优化策略

图片来源于网络,如有侵权联系删除

(1)实体:表中的每一行代表一个实体,即一个具体的数据记录。

(2)属性:表中的每一列代表一个属性,即实体的某个特征。

(3)关系:表与表之间的关系,通过外键实现。

2、关系表

关系型数据库中的数据以关系表的形式存储,每个关系表包含以下要素:

(1)表名:唯一标识一个关系表。

(2)列名:唯一标识一个属性。

(3)数据类型:定义属性的数据类型,如整数、字符串、日期等。

(4)约束:对数据施加的限制,如主键、外键、唯一性约束等。

3、索引

索引是关系型数据库中用于提高查询效率的一种数据结构,它通过存储数据记录的指针,实现快速定位数据,索引分为以下几种类型:

关系型数据库的结构是什么,关系型数据库的结构是,关系型数据库结构的深入剖析与优化策略

图片来源于网络,如有侵权联系删除

(1)单列索引:只针对一个属性建立索引。

(2)复合索引:针对多个属性建立索引。

(3)全文索引:对文本内容进行索引,实现全文检索。

关系型数据库优化策略

1、索引优化

(1)合理设计索引:根据查询需求,选择合适的索引类型和索引列。

(2)避免过度索引:过多的索引会增加数据库的维护成本,降低性能。

(3)定期维护索引:定期重建或重新组织索引,提高查询效率。

2、数据库设计优化

(1)合理设计表结构:遵循规范化原则,避免数据冗余和更新异常。

(2)合理设计字段类型:根据数据特点选择合适的数据类型,提高存储效率。

(3)优化数据存储:合理分区、分片,提高数据访问速度。

关系型数据库的结构是什么,关系型数据库的结构是,关系型数据库结构的深入剖析与优化策略

图片来源于网络,如有侵权联系删除

3、查询优化

(1)合理编写SQL语句:遵循最佳实践,提高查询效率。

(2)使用索引优化查询:合理使用索引,避免全表扫描。

(3)避免复杂查询:简化查询逻辑,降低查询复杂度。

4、硬件优化

(1)提高CPU性能:采用多核处理器,提高数据处理能力。

(2)增加内存:提高数据库缓存能力,减少磁盘I/O操作。

(3)使用高性能存储设备:提高数据读写速度。

关系型数据库结构以其简洁、高效的特点,在信息系统中得到了广泛应用,本文深入剖析了关系型数据库的结构,并探讨了优化策略,旨在提升数据库的性能和稳定性,在实际应用中,应根据具体需求,综合运用各种优化手段,实现数据库的卓越表现。

标签: #关系数据库结构 #关系型数据库模型 #数据库结构优化

黑狐家游戏
  • 评论列表

留言评论